Turbine Vent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Turbine vent repair services focus on maintaining and restoring the functionality of turbine vents, which are essential components for ventilating attics and roofing spaces. These vents help regulate temperature and moisture levels, preventing damage such as mold, rot, or ice dam formation. Projects typically involve fixing or replacing damaged blades, seals, or housings, and ensuring the vents are properly secured and functioning as intended. Homeowners considering turbine vent repair should understand the importance of regular inspections to identify issues early, as well as the potential signs of malfunction such as excessive noise, leaks, or decreased airflow.

Turbine Vent Repair Questions
What are common signs of a turbine vent needing repair? Signs include persistent leaks, unusual noises, or the vent not spinning properly during windy conditions.
Can turbine vent repairs improve energy efficiency? Yes, repairing or replacing damaged vents can help maintain proper attic ventilation and reduce energy costs.
What types of damage require turbine vent repair? Damage such as bent blades, rust, or broken components can impair vent function and may need repair or replacement.
